Abstract
The utility model discloses a kind of hole tray ordering machines, it is equipped with lifting support, pusher bar support, mechanical arm and traveling wheel on pedestal, support plate is equipped on lifting support, the inner ring of pivoting support is fixed on the supporting plate, and linking arm is equipped on the outer ring of pivoting support, supporting plate is equipped on linking arm, supporting plate is equipped with hole tray bracket, and there are the gear teeth, the gear teeth to be meshed with driving gear on the outer ring of pivoting support, pusher bar support is connected across inner ring with the first electric pushrod, and aperture disk conveyor is equipped on mechanical arm.The device integrates transport and quick balance, and not damaged to seed when hole tray stacks, work efficiency is high, mitigates artificial burden, can be with effectively save cost.

Background technology
Hole plate seedling growth technology in greenhouse is quickly grown in China, is according to statistics to use culturing and transplanting seedlings there are about 60% vegetables
What mode was planted.When nursery, by substrate soil of the seed sowing in each well of hole tray, it is big that hole tray is then carried to greenhouse
Seedling is carried out in canopy.Currently, have more mature efficient equipment in hole tray sowing link, but it is also main in hole plate seedling raising link
Carrying and the balance operation of hole tray are realized by manually, and during being somebody's turn to do, multiple soft hole trays are directly stacked together, and are easy to make
Substrate soil and seed in hole tray are squeezed damage, influence Quality of Seedlings, and by manually by one disk of hole tray, one disk into
Capable not only labor intensity of putting is big, but also inefficiency, seedling cost are difficult to decline, and are unfavorable for the overall development of nursery industry.
So far also do not find there is the hole tray arranging apparatus that can integrate transport and efficient balance.

Specific implementation mode
Below in conjunction with the accompanying drawings, the utility model is described further:
As shown in Figures 1 to 7, this hole tray ordering machine has pedestal 1, and pedestal 1 can be enclosed by proximate matter, under pedestal 1
Diagonally peace is equipped with driving motor 4, can drive AGV rudders there are two AGV steering wheels 2 and two universal wheels 3 on AGV steering wheels 2 for side
2 movement of wheel, AGV steering wheels 2 and the combination of universal wheel 3 may be implemented non-semidiameter turn, make whole device freely smooth movement, realize
Transport.
There are two free bearings 5 for peace on pedestal 1, are respectively articulated with the first scissors rod 6 and the second scissors rod 7,1 top of pedestal thereon
Support plate 18 on peace there are two free bearing 8, be respectively articulated with third scissors rod 9 and the 4th scissors rod 10, and the first scissor thereon
It is installed with axis pin 11 among bar 6 and third scissors rod 9, axis pin 12 is installed among the second scissors rod 7 and the 4th scissors rod 10.First cuts
6 upper end of fork arm is equipped with idler wheel 13, and 7 upper end of the second scissors rod is equipped with idler wheel 14, and the lower end of third scissors rod 9 is equipped with idler wheel 15, the
The lower end of four scissors rods 10 is equipped with idler wheel 16.In 18 downside of support plate, there are the first parallel orbits 17 and 14 phase of idler wheel 13 and idler wheel
Corresponding, it is corresponding with idler wheel 15 and idler wheel 16 that there are the second parallel orbits 19 on pedestal 1, and above-mentioned rollers can be in corresponding rail
It is rotated on road.First connecting rod 20, third scissors rod 9 and the 4th scissors rod 10 are equipped between first scissors rod 6 and the second scissors rod 7
Between be connected with second connecting rod 21, the second electric pushrod 22 is equipped between first connecting rod 20 and second connecting rod 21, second electronic pushes away
Bar 22, which elongates or shortens, can drive the lifting support being made of the first, second, third, fourth scissors rod to be raised and lowered, into
And support plate 18 is made to be raised and lowered with respect to pedestal 1.It is above-mentioned by one group of lifting support that totally four scissors rods form in order to realize
Rise or fall need using idler wheel formation move freely end, can also utilize two groups totally eight or more group scissors rods press it is similar
Mode forms lifting support, can also use other structures lifting support, with can realize support plate 18 rise or fall for
It is accurate.
It is equipped with pivoting support 23 at the middle part of support plate 18, pivoting support 23 is composed of inner ring 231 and outer ring 232,
There are the gear teeth 233 on outer ring, can be as buying obtained by standard component.At the middle part of support plate 18 there are circular hole, the bore edges with it is interior
Circle 231 is fixed through screw.Four orthogonal linking arms 24 are connected on outer ring 232, each linking arm is T-shaped, and taper end connects outer ring
232, wide end connects supporting plate 25, the hole tray bracket 26 with multiple transverse direction grids is provided with supporting plate 25 above, in each grid
A disk hole tray 27 can be placed, such hole tray bracket 26 can integrally place multiple hole trays 27, and hole tray is avoided mutually to squeeze, with
Protection seed simultaneously ensures seedling quality.The gear teeth 233 are meshed with driving gear 28, the output shaft of driving gear and first motor 29
It is connected, first motor 29 is mounted on by electric machine support 30 in support plate 18.First motor 29 and driving gear 28 in this way can
It drives outer ring 232 to rotate by the gear teeth 233, and then makes aforementioned four linking arm 24 and supporting plate 25 up conversion position in the horizontal direction
It sets.It is equipped with the rolling element 31 that serves as of roller in the lower section of each supporting plate 25, is rolled in support plate 18 by rolling element 31, it can be with
Enhance fluency and stability that supporting plate 25 rotates, rolling element 31 can also be served as using spin.
Pusher bar support 32 is equipped on pedestal, pusher bar support 32 is upward through the inner ring of the pivoting support 23 in support plate 18
231, it is laterally equipped with the first electric pushrod 33 at the top of pusher bar support 32, one end horizontal vertical of the first electric pushrod 33 is equipped with
Push plate 34, push plate 34 can increase the contact area of the first electric pushrod 33 and hole tray 27, more stable when pushing hole tray 27.The
One electric pushrod 33 and push plate 34, which travel forward, to be inserted into releasing in the grid of hole tray bracket 26 and by the hole tray 27 in it.It rises
The height of the first electric pushrod 33 is constant when descending branch frame drives support plate 18, supporting plate 25 and hole tray bracket 26 to move up and down, thus
It can make the hole tray 27 that the first electric pushrod 33 is respectively aligned in different grids and release them, pass through above-mentioned outer ring 232
Rotation and the first electric pushrod 33 does not rotate, four hole tray brackets 26 on four supporting plates 25 electronic can be pushed away with first respectively
The push plate 34 of bar 33 is opposite, releases multiple hole trays 27 in each hole tray bracket 26 respectively to realize.
Mechanical arm 35 is equipped on pedestal 1, mechanical arm may be used the common free manipulator of height and serve as, can also press
The mode of stating makes:The the first arm group 351 and two the second arm groups 352 being mutually parallel that i.e. mechanical arm 35 is mutually parallel by two connect
It connects, first joint motor and retarder 353 is equipped in the junction of the first arm group 351 and pedestal 1, in the first arm group and second
The junction of arm group is equipped with middle joint motor and retarder 354, and last joint motor and deceleration are equipped in the end of the second arm group 352
Device 355.The end of mechanical arm 35 is equipped with aperture disk conveyor 36, and in the present embodiment, aperture disk conveyor 36 is mounted on active rubber roll 37
On driven rubber roller 38, active rubber roll 37 and driven rubber roller 38 are mounted in conveyor belt frame 39, active rubber roll 37 and the second electricity
40 synchronized band 41 of machine is connected with synchronous pulley 42, and conveyor belt frame 39 is through shaft 43 and last joint motor and retarder 355
Output shaft is connected.Above three joint motor freely swings with calculation device driving mechanical arm 35 is subtracted, and ensures that hole tray conveys when swing
Band remains horizontal.
When the present apparatus works, it will manually broadcast the hole tray planted and be inserted into successively in the grid of four hole tray brackets, then walk
Wheel movement, the present apparatus is moved in the greenhouse for needing balance, and the first electric pushrod releases a disk hole tray and by mechanical arm
Aperture disk conveyor receives, then table top or bottom surface of the manipulator motion to suitable height, and hole tray is sent out in aperture disk conveyor movement
To table top or bottom surface, a balance is completed, then mechanical revolution of arm.Lifting support rises, and keeps the alignment of the first electric pushrod next
Hole tray is released again.After the hole tray in one group of hole tray bracket has been put, active motor action, 90 degree of supporting plate rotation, then
Above-mentioned similar operations are implemented to the hole tray in next group of hole tray bracket.
